These hernias are typically acquired and are mainly caused by increased abdominal pressure. Umbilical hernias do not heal on their own and usually require surgical intervention.\n\nThe external oblique and rectus abdominis plane (EXORA) block is an emerging technique providing a sensory block to the anterolateral abdominal wall. The EXORA block involves local anaesthetic injection into the fascial plane between the external oblique and rectus abdominis muscles.
